1 d
Databricks secrets scope?
Follow
11
Databricks secrets scope?
Add secrets to the scope. It's possible using SQL scripts. It seams that the only alternative is the CLI option described by Alex Ott. Navigate to the “Secrets” tab in the workspace. Sometimes turning it off and on again is underrated, so I gave up finding the problem, deleted it and re-created the scope - worked a breeze! Mine seems like it was something silly, I was able to set up my vault but got the same issue when trying to use it 1hr later - even when logged in as myself, an admin of the workspace. You must have WRITE or MANAGE permission on the secret scope. dvasdekis mentioned this issue Nov 16, 2021. To delete a secret from a scope backed by Azure Key Vault, use the Azure SetSecret REST API or Azure portal UI. Learn about sniper scopes and see pictures of sniper scopes Ryobi’s Phone Works Inspection Scope features a waterproof, LED-lit camera that you can stick inside a wall or pipe. Covering scars with makeup can help make them disappear. Mar 5, 2023 · Secrets. Throws RESOURCE_DOES_NOT_EXIST if no such secret scope or secret exists. First list the scopes using: dbutilslistScopes() (Thanks to Matkurek) And then list the secret names within specific scopes using: dbutilslist("SCOPE_NAME") This might help you pin down which vault the scope points to. Secret scope names are case insensitive. Throws PERMISSION_DENIED if the user does not have permission to make this API call. I am not expecting this behaviour as this. Aug 10, 2023 · Aug 10, 2023 At the time of writing this post, two primary methods are available for creating scopes and secrets in Databricks: utilizing the CLI and leveraging the REST API Sep 16, 2022 · The simplest way to create a secret scope is not to use API, but instead use the Databricks CLI - there is a command to create a secret scope: databricks secrets create-scope --scope --key Post Opinion Like What is your opinion?Add Opinion
Click "Show More" for your mentions
Add your reply For "{0}"
We're glad to see you liked this post.
You can also add your opinion below!
Loading...
What Girls & Guys Said
Opinion
13Opinion
secret command to delete the secret-scopes, you need to use the Databricks CLI to delete the scopes. To connect to SQL Server from Azure Databricks without hardcoding the SQL username and password, you can create secrets in Azure Key Vault to store the username and password. Note: There is no dbutils. See Step 1: Store the GitHub token in a secret. To create a Databricks secret: Log in to your Databricks workspace. databricks-h Criar um Secret Scope apoiado pelo Databricks. However, to ensure their success, it is crucial to define clear objectives and scope right from the start If you own a Shot Scope golf GPS watch, you know how important it is to keep it charged and ready for your next round. with the name of the key containing the client secret. I wanted to understand if it is not supported, or would. To use the Databricks CLI to create an Azure Key Vault-backed secret scope, run databricks secrets create-scope --help to display information about additional --scope-backend-type. You need to update the secret in the Key vault, and databricks secret scope will read the updated secret from Key vault. Oct 27, 2021 · In order to use it securely in Azure DataBricks, have created the secret scope and configured the Azure Key Vault properties. Add secrets to the scope. You must have WRITE or MANAGE permission on the secret scope. 3 : Set up a secret. Databricks recommends enabling table access control on all clusters or managing access to secrets using secret scopes. verizon arc xci55ax Utilities: data, fs, jobs, library, notebook, secrets. For more information, see Secret redaction. dvasdekis mentioned this issue Nov 16, 2021. My sample: Secret scope: For sample I have used the below secret. The secret resource scope can be imported using the scope name. Online business coach Pamela Wilson shares 7 secrets to building trust and closing sales which are highly effective and easy to implement. But, I can able to see the value of the secrets if the name of the scope is known. You can use the same command which is available in document to delete a Databricks backend managed scopes and Azure KeyVault Backend managed scopes. However, the spark context name is identical on all cluster. When I use Azure's Key Vault, when creating the scope, it uses the option -scope-backend-type AZURE_KEYVAULT, but I didn't find it for AWS. Running this command in Databricks notebook - jwt. Must consist of alphanumeric characters, dashes, underscores, @, and periods, and may not exceed 128 characters. blackcunts Navigate to the "Secrets" tab in the workspace. The names are considered non-sensitive and are. A Databricks-backed secret scope is stored in (backed by) an encrypted database owned and managed by Databricks. If you have the Premium plan, assign access control to the secret scope. - The name of your scope that holds the secrets. My understanding is that the Key name is the "thing" you are trying to retrieve from the secret scope. Access the Azure Databricks workspace. -> Warning To create a secret scope from Azure Key Vault, you must use one of the Azure-specific authentication. I created a secret on databricks using the secrets API. Out of curiosity, just wanted to check whether my key is safe and secure. Click Edit next to the Cluster information. I have the cluster ID and cluster secret ID stored in Databricks secret scope. Delete a secret /api/2 Deletes the secret stored in this secret scope. Must consist of alphanumeric characters, dashes, underscores, @, and periods, and may not exceed 128 characters. The scope is the namespace in which multiple keys might reside. Here is the update to connect to a SQL database from azure databricks Databricks Workspace Repos Delete an ACL Delete a secret Add a secret. Under Access policies, create an access policy for Databricks to use when it accesses the Key Vault Databricks access policy. Secrets are stored within secret scopes - containers held within an encrypted database hosted, owned and managed by Databricks themself. Please consult Secrets User Guide for more details. Using the Databricks UI. Hello, After implementing the use of Secret Scope to store Secrets in an azure key vault, i faced a problem. databricks secrets put-acl --scope jdbc --principal datascience --permission READ. A workspace is limited to a maximum of 100 secret scopes. list_secrets April 18, 2024. safesport unit 3 post test answers initial_manage_principal string. Query on using secret scope for dbt-core integration with databricks workflow. By managing secret scopes in Databricks, you can keep your sensitive data secure while allowing authorized users and applications to access it when needed If you’re aiming to obtain the Databricks certified Data Engineer Associate certification, take a look at these helpful tips. Now I declare another variable as below. Databricks-backed: A Databricks-backed scope is stored in (backed by) an Azure Databricks database. with the name of a container in the ADLS Gen2 storage account. Options. 01-26-2023 09:29 AM. Usage: databricks secrets [OPTIONS] COMMAND [ARGS]. This protects the Azure credentials while allowing users to access Azure storage. Cannot create Databricks secret scope with Terraform - Key Vault exists and needs to be imported/Key Vault not available List the ACLs for a given secret scope. Click on “Create > Scope” to define a. See Step 1: Store the GitHub token in a secret. All community This category This board Knowledge base Users Products cancel databricks secrets list-scopes Secrets API を使用して、既存のスコープを一覧表示することもできます。 シークレットのスコープを削除する. Aug 10, 2023 · Aug 10, 2023 At the time of writing this post, two primary methods are available for creating scopes and secrets in Databricks: utilizing the CLI and leveraging the REST API Sep 16, 2022 · The simplest way to create a secret scope is not to use API, but instead use the Databricks CLI - there is a command to create a secret scope: databricks secrets create-scope --scope \ --scope-backend-type AZURE_KEYVAULT --resource-id \ --dns-name Sep 16, 2022 · The simplest way to create a secret scope is not to use API, but instead use the Databricks CLI - there is a command to create a secret scope: databricks secrets create-scope --scope \ --scope-backend-type AZURE_KEYVAULT --resource-id \ --dns-name The principal that is initially granted MANAGE permission to the created scope. There is Key Vault Secret named "StorageGen2Secret" and it has secret value of DataLakeSecrets.
Azure Key Vault-backed scopes: scope is related to a Key Vault. External models are third-party models hosted outside of Databricks. Add secrets to the scope. If a secret already exists with the same name, this command overwrites the existing secret's value. Resources are created with functions called constructors. There's some hint in the documentation about the secret being "not accessible from a program running in. To create secret scope using CLI you need to run it from your personal computer, for example, that has Databricks CLI installed. liz cheney approval rating wyoming If not specified, will default to DATABRICKS. Users must have the MANAGE permission to invoke this API. My secret value in Azure key vault is like below. Read more about how endoscopy works and why it's done. Latest Version Version 10 Published 2 years ago Version 10 Published 2 years ago Version 11 Databricks recommends enabling table access control on all clusters or managing access to secrets using secret scopes. By managing secret scopes in Databricks, you can keep your sensitive data secure while allowing authorized users and applications to access it when needed If you’re aiming to obtain the Databricks certified Data Engineer Associate certification, take a look at these helpful tips. Sometimes accessing data requires that you authenticate to external data sources through JDBC. ols login Instead of using the {{secrets/scope/secret}} syntax, you can try using environment variables. Log in to the Databricks platform and navigate to the Secrets tab. Nardil is a little used but highly effective antidepressant when others don’t work. But when I tried connecting to key vault to create secret scope the dns for this key vault is not getting resolved but at the same time it is working with without NPIP WORKSPACE hosted in a private VNET The Control panel is in a different place. Databricks-backed: A Databricks-backed scope is stored in (backed by) an Azure Databricks database. In this article: Step 1: Create a service principal. Os nomes de Secret Scope não se diferenciam por maiúsculas e minúsculas. Add secrets to the scope. bishoujomom While Databricks makes an effort to redact secret values that might be displayed in notebooks, it is not possible to prevent such users from reading secrets. Type your secret and save. Mounted ADLS gen2 container using service principal secret as secret from Azure Key Vault-backed secret scope. Writing a scope of study requires identifying the limitations and delimitations of the study, what data is used for the research and what theories are employed to interpret that da.
databricks secrets delete-scope --scope. If not specified, will default to DATABRICKS 200 This method might return the following HTTP codes: 400. You can grant users, service principals, and groups in your workspace access to read the secret scope. Applies to: Databricks SQL preview Databricks Runtime 11 Returns the keys which the user is authorized to see from Databricks secret service. However, the user's permission will be applied based on who is executing the command, and they must have at least READ permission. with the name of a container in the ADLS Gen2 storage account. Like, really freaking hard Ed. By clicking "TRY IT", I. Ultimatum here is the value of the key shouldn't exposed in DataBricks notebook. When building solutions in Databricks you need to ensure that all your credentials are securely stored. ; Instead of using an equal sign (=) in your value, you can try using a different. Azure Key Vault backed → We will use Key Vault in this type and it will be created using UI (no commands) Databricks Backed → Secret Scope is. Having the Secret Scope in Azure Databricks created by someone who has such rights already in place (like the Administrator). Step 1: Configure Azure Key Vault Secrets in Azure Databricks. A secret scope is a collection of secrets identified by a name. Aug 10, 2023 At the time of writing this post, two primary methods are available for creating scopes and secrets in Databricks: utilizing the CLI and leveraging the REST API The simplest way to create a secret scope is not to use API, but instead use the Databricks CLI - there is a command to create a secret scope: databricks secrets create-scope --scope \ --scope-backend-type AZURE_KEYVAULT --resource-id \ --dns-name The principal that is initially granted MANAGE permission to the created scope. If a secret already exists with the same name, this command overwrites the existing secret's value. Right now, every notebook has this at the. Note: There is no dbutils. Yes, you can't do that using AAD token issued for a service principal - it works only with AAD token of real user. In this article: Syntax Returns. 10. Creating DataBricks Azure Key Vault Secret Scope Backend using Rest Api and DataBricks CLI How to force refresh secret used to mount ADLS Gen2? Azure Databricks mounts using Azure KeyVault-backed scope -- SP secret update The following example uses the Databricks CLI to create a secret scope and store the key in that secret scope. If you can view the secrets, the issue is resolved. Please follow these two docs - Learn how to use Azure Key Vault to securely store and access secrets in Azure Databricks, a unified data analytics platform that helps organisations accelerate innovation. imbd cats Each AAD group contains a service principal and the credentials for each service principal have been stored in a unique secret scope. Now any member of that group can read these credentials, and we only need to manage a single set of credentials for this use case in Databricks! Technical Details. Aug 10, 2023 · Aug 10, 2023 At the time of writing this post, two primary methods are available for creating scopes and secrets in Databricks: utilizing the CLI and leveraging the REST API Sep 16, 2022 · The simplest way to create a secret scope is not to use API, but instead use the Databricks CLI - there is a command to create a secret scope: databricks secrets create-scope --scope \ --scope-backend-type AZURE_KEYVAULT --resource-id \ --dns-name Sep 16, 2022 · The simplest way to create a secret scope is not to use API, but instead use the Databricks CLI - there is a command to create a secret scope: databricks secrets create-scope --scope \ --scope-backend-type AZURE_KEYVAULT --resource-id \ --dns-name The principal that is initially granted MANAGE permission to the created scope. There is no API to read the actual secret value material outside of a cluster. txt If successful, no output is displayed. databricks secrets create-scope --scope my-scope If successful, no output is displayed. Databricks-backed: This is a store in. During model serving, the secrets are retrieved from Databricks secrets by the secret scope and key. Weaver metal scope bases are an essential accessory for any avid shooter or hunter. databricks secrets create-scope. Must consist of alphanumeric characters, dashes, underscores, @, and periods, and may not exceed 128 characters. Click Edit next to the Cluster information. To store the OpenAI API key as a secret, you can use the Databricks Secrets CLI (version 0 You can also use the REST API for secrets. To create a Databricks personal access token for your Databricks workspace user, do the following: In your Databricks workspace, click your Databricks username in the top bar, and then select Settings from the drop down Next to Access tokens, click Manage. value city furniture md locations Run the following commands and enter the secret values in the opened editor. Endoscopy is a procedure that lets your doctor look ins. SECRET_FUNCTION_SCOPE_NOT_CONSTANT The SECRET function requires the secret scope as a constant string expression passed in the first argument. Resources are created with functions called constructors. Secret scope names are case insensitive. I want to use a function. These bases provide a sturdy and secure platform for mounting your scope onto your firearm, ensu. You must have WRITE or MANAGE permission on the secret scope. 3 : Set up a secret. Databricks recommends using secret scopes for storing all credentials. with the name of a container in the ADLS Gen2 storage account. Options. 01-26-2023 09:29 AM. txt Or: databricks secrets write --scope my-scope --key my-key --binary-file my-secret. Throws RESOURCE_DOES_NOT_EXIST if no such secret scope or secret exists. Step 3: Create an OAuth secret for a service principal. Using the Databricks UI. If you are still getting the INVALID_STATE: Databricks could not access keyvault error, continue troubleshooting. Then a notepad will be opened and you have to enter whatever the. Terraform. Databricks-backed: A Databricks-backed scope is stored in (backed by) an Azure Databricks database. This article is a reference for Databricks Utilities ( dbutils ). The recent Databricks funding round, a $1 billion investment at a $28 billion valuation, was one of the year’s most notable private investments so far. There's some hint in the documentation about the secret being "not accessible from a program running in. Step 1: Create a secret scope.